如何远程服务器上发布网站

fiy 其他 84

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要远程服务器上发布网站,可以按以下步骤进行:

    1. 获取远程服务器的访问权限:首先,你需要有一台远程服务器,并且拥有访问权限。这可以通过与服务器管理员联系并获取登录凭据实现。

    2. 连接到远程服务器:使用远程登录协议,如SSH,通过终端或SSH客户端连接到远程服务器。在命令行中输入服务器的IP地址和凭据,然后按Enter键登录。

    3. 安装网站所需的软件和服务:在远程服务器上安装Web服务器软件,如Apache、Nginx或IIS。你还需要安装适当的编程语言环境(如PHP、Python、Java等),以及与数据库(如MySQL、PostgreSQL等)集成的软件。

    4. 配置Web服务器:在安装和配置Web服务器后,你需要指定网站的根目录和默认文档,以及任何其他必要的配置。这些信息通常由Web服务器的配置文件管理,如Apache的httpd.conf文件或Nginx的nginx.conf文件。

    5. 上传网站文件:将本地开发环境中的网站文件上传到远程服务器。你可以使用FTP(文件传输协议),SCP(安全文件复制)或其他文件传输工具来完成此操作。请确保将文件复制到正确的位置,并确保文件权限设置正确。

    6. 设置数据库连接:如果你的网站使用数据库,需要在远程服务器上创建数据库,并将数据库连接信息更新到网站代码中。这通常涉及到编辑配置文件或环境变量。

    7. 测试网站:完成上述步骤后,你可以在Web浏览器中输入远程服务器的IP地址或域名,以测试发布的网站是否正常运行。确保测试所有页面和功能,以确保一切正常。

    以上是远程服务器上发布网站的基本步骤。根据你使用的具体技术和工具,可能会有一些额外的步骤或配置。重要的是仔细阅读相关文档并遵循最佳实践,以确保网站在远程服务器上成功发布。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要远程服务器上发布网站,您需要遵循以下步骤:

    1. 选择合适的远程服务器:首先,您需要选择一个合适的远程服务器来托管您的网站。该服务器应具备稳定的网络连接和足够的存储空间,并且可提供所需的操作系统和硬件资源。

    2. 安装和配置服务器环境:一旦您选择了合适的远程服务器,接下来需要安装和配置服务器环境。这包括安装操作系统、配置网络设置、安装必要的软件(如Web服务器软件、数据库服务器、PHP解释器等)。

    3. 上传网站文件:您需要将网站文件上传到远程服务器。这可以通过使用FTP(文件传输协议)或SSH(安全外壳协议)等工具来完成。确保将所有网站文件包括在上传的文件夹中,并将其放置在您选择的网站根目录下。

    4. 设置域名和DNS:如果您有自己的域名,您需要将其配置到远程服务器上。这涉及到在域名注册商处设置DNS记录,将域名指向您的服务器的IP地址。这样,当用户在浏览器中输入您的域名时,他们将被重定向到您的远程服务器上。

    5. 测试和调试:一旦网站文件已经上传并配置好,您应该进行测试和调试以确保一切正常工作。这包括在各种浏览器和设备上测试网站的兼容性,确保页面加载速度快且功能正常。

    总结:发布网站到远程服务器需要选择合适的服务器,安装和配置服务器环境,上传网站文件,设置域名和DNS,并测试和调试网站。按照这些步骤,您将能够成功地将您的网站发布到远程服务器上。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    远程服务器上发布网站的步骤可以分为以下几个方面:

    1. 选择合适的远程服务器
      首先需要选择一台合适的远程服务器来托管你的网站。可以选择使用虚拟私有服务器(VPS)、云服务器或者专用服务器。根据你的需求和预算来选择一个适合的服务器。

    2. 选择合适的操作系统
      根据你选择的服务器,确定要使用的操作系统。常见的选择有Linux(如Ubuntu、CentOS等)和Windows Server。Linux操作系统在Web服务器方面具有很大的优势,所以通常会推荐使用Linux作为服务器操作系统。

    3. 安装必要的软件
      根据你选择的服务器操作系统,安装必要的软件。对于Linux服务器,通常需要安装Web服务器软件(如Apache、Nginx)、数据库软件(如MySQL)、PHP解释器等。对于Windows服务器,可以选择使用IIS作为Web服务器,Microsoft SQL Server作为数据库服务器,以及ASP.NET等。

    4. 配置服务器环境
      根据你的网站需求,进行服务器环境的配置。例如,配置域名和DNS解析,设置SSL证书以实现网站的HTTPS加密访问,打开必要的端口以允许外部访问等。

    5. 上传网站文件
      将你的网站文件上传到服务器。可以使用FTP、SFTP、RSYNC等工具将本地文件上传到远程服务器的指定目录中。确保上传的文件包括网站的HTML、CSS、JavaScript文件,以及任何需要的图片、视频或其他相关资源文件。

    6. 配置网站设置
      根据你的网站需求,进行网站设置。例如,配置网站的虚拟主机、域名绑定、URL重定向、错误页面定制等。你也可以安装并配置相应的CMS(内容管理系统)或框架来简化网站的管理和维护。

    7. 测试和优化
      在发布网站之前,务必进行测试和优化。确保网站在不同浏览器和设备上都能正常显示,检查页面加载速度和性能,修复可能的错误和漏洞等。

    8. 域名解析
      如果你的域名没有直接解析到服务器的IP地址,需要进行域名解析的配置。在域名管理面板中,将域名指向你的服务器IP地址,这样用户访问域名时就能访问你的网站了。

    以上是远程服务器上发布网站的一般步骤,具体的操作流程会根据你所选择的服务器和软件环境而有所差异。确保在操作过程中保持耐心和谨慎,备份关键数据,并随时检查和更新服务器的安全性和性能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部